About This Novel
Lin Mu, an otaku, was playing Plants vs. Zombies, but was accidentally hit by a gourd and his soul traveled through time. He became a dispensable waste in a big family and a small lord in a desolate land! There is a strange energy in the body of the forest tree called sunlight. It can make the plants grow and mature quickly, and it can also make the plant-type monsters like the forest tree! The most amazing thing is that among the gourds carried by the trees, there is a villa. The trees in the front yard of the villa are full of sunflowers, which are used to collect sunlight! The garden is filled with marigolds, which are used to produce money; the backyard is filled with potato mines and piranha, which are used for ambushes! There is a lone lotus planted in the swimming pool, and strangely there is a farm, but why does Mao have no pasture? Could it be that the data is messed up?
